Understanding the Core Concept of DUT

Dynamic Unstable Training (DUT) is a specialized form of exercise that deliberately introduces instability into movements. Unlike traditional strength training where the goal is often to maximize external load on a stable platform, DUT focuses on enhancing the body's intrinsic stabilization mechanisms.

Dynamic refers to movements that involve motion, often across multiple joints, rather than static holds. Unstable refers to the environment or equipment used, which provides an unpredictable or shifting base of support, forcing the body to work harder to maintain equilibrium.

The fundamental premise of DUT is that by creating an unstable environment, the body is compelled to recruit a greater number of stabilizing muscles, particularly those of the core, and to improve its proprioceptive awareness – the sense of where one's body is in space.

The Science Behind Unstable Training

The effectiveness of DUT stems from its impact on the neuromuscular system:

  • Proprioception and Balance: Unstable surfaces stimulate mechanoreceptors in joints, muscles, and tendons, sending increased sensory information to the central nervous system. This enhances proprioception, leading to improved balance and coordination.
  • Neuromuscular Control: To counteract instability, the brain must rapidly process sensory input and send precise motor commands to multiple muscle groups, improving the efficiency and speed of muscle recruitment patterns. This enhanced neuromuscular control is crucial for injury prevention and athletic performance.
  • Core Activation: While often touted as a primary benefit, the activation of core musculature during unstable exercises is more about stabilization and co-contraction than maximal force production. The deep intrinsic core muscles (e.g., transversus abdominis, multifidus) work synergistically with superficial muscles to maintain spinal stability.
  • Afferent Feedback: The constant need to correct balance provides a rich source of afferent (sensory) feedback, which helps refine motor programs and improve movement efficiency.

Benefits of Incorporating DUT

Integrating DUT into a fitness regimen can yield several distinct advantages:

  • Enhanced Balance and Stability: Directly improves the ability to maintain equilibrium, crucial for daily activities, sports, and preventing falls.
  • Improved Proprioception and Kinesthetic Awareness: Heightens the body's spatial awareness, leading to more coordinated and efficient movements.
  • Stronger Stabilizer Muscles: While not always leading to significant gains in maximal strength for prime movers, DUT effectively targets and strengthens the smaller, deeper muscles responsible for joint stability.
  • Injury Prevention: By improving joint stability and neuromuscular control, DUT can reduce the risk of sprains, strains, and other musculoskeletal injuries, particularly in the ankles, knees, and hips.
  • Rehabilitation Aid: Widely used in physical therapy to restore function, balance, and confidence after injuries, especially those affecting the lower extremities.
  • Sport-Specific Training: Many sports require dynamic balance and rapid adjustments (e.g., basketball, soccer, martial arts), making DUT highly relevant for athletes.
  • Functional Fitness: Translates well to real-world movements and activities, making everyday tasks feel easier and safer.

Common Tools and Modalities for DUT

Various equipment types are utilized to introduce instability:

  • Balance Boards: Such as wobble boards (multi-directional tilt) and rocker boards (single-plane tilt).
  • Stability Balls (Swiss Balls): Used for exercises like ball crunches, planks, or even squats with the ball against a wall.
  • BOSU Balls (Both Sides Up): A dome-shaped device with a flat base, offering different levels of instability depending on which side is up.
  • Foam Rollers: Can be used as an unstable surface for exercises like lunges or single-leg stands.
  • Suspension Trainers (e.g., TRX): Utilize bodyweight and a suspension system to create instability, particularly in upper body and core exercises.
  • Uneven Surfaces: Simply performing exercises on sand, grass, or a thick mat can introduce a degree of instability.
  • Single-Leg Stances: Standing on one leg, even on a stable surface, is a foundational DUT exercise.

Designing a DUT Workout: Principles and Progression

Effective implementation of DUT requires careful planning and progressive overload:

  • Master Stable Movements First: Ensure proficiency and proper form in an exercise on a stable surface before introducing instability. For example, master a bodyweight squat before attempting it on a BOSU ball.
  • Gradual Progression: Start with minimal instability and gradually increase the challenge. This could mean moving from a two-legged stance to a single-legged stance, or from a less unstable tool (e.g., foam pad) to a more unstable one (e.g., wobble board).
  • Prioritize Control Over Load: The primary goal in DUT is neuromuscular control and stability, not lifting maximal weight. Focus on slow, controlled movements and perfect form.
  • Integrate Smartly: DUT can be incorporated into warm-ups, as part of a main workout, or as a finisher. It's often best used as a complement to traditional strength training, rather than a replacement, especially for goals like hypertrophy or maximal strength.
  • Exercise Examples:
    • Lower Body: Single-leg balance on a BOSU, squats on a stability cushion, lunges with the rear foot on a stability ball.
    • Upper Body: Push-ups with hands on a stability ball, single-arm rows with the body on an unstable surface.
    • Core: Plank on a stability ball, bird-dog on a BOSU.

Who Can Benefit from DUT?

While beneficial for many, DUT is particularly advantageous for:

  • Athletes: Especially those in sports requiring high levels of balance, agility, and quick changes of direction (e.g., basketball, soccer, gymnastics, combat sports).
  • Individuals Seeking Improved Core Strength and Stability: Those looking to enhance their core's ability to stabilize the spine and transfer force efficiently.
  • Rehabilitation Patients: Under the guidance of a physical therapist, DUT is critical for restoring function, proprioception, and confidence after injuries, particularly to the ankle, knee, or hip.
  • Older Adults: To improve balance, reduce the risk of falls, and maintain functional independence.
  • General Fitness Enthusiasts: Looking to add variety to their workouts, improve body control, and address muscular imbalances.

Important Considerations and Potential Limitations

While beneficial, DUT is not without its considerations:

  • Reduced Force Production: Performing exercises on unstable surfaces typically reduces the amount of weight or resistance that can be used. Therefore, DUT is not the most efficient method for maximizing muscle hypertrophy or absolute strength gains.
  • Risk of Injury: If performed incorrectly, without proper progression, or by individuals with significant balance deficits, DUT can increase the risk of falls or sprains.
  • Specificity Debate: While effective for balance and stability, the transferability of DUT gains to maximal strength or power in highly stable environments is debated. It's crucial to consider the specific demands of an individual's goals or sport.
  • Professional Guidance: For beginners, individuals with pre-existing conditions, or those in rehabilitation, seeking guidance from a certified personal trainer, strength and conditioning specialist, or physical therapist is highly recommended to ensure safe and effective progression.
